Press3 Project Context
This repository hosts Press3, a decentralized CMS built on SUI with Walrus storage. The system combines three main components:
- Smart contract package – manages pages, permissions, Walrus blobs, edit queues, and emits events for frontends.
- Walrus-hosted frontends – both a public site renderer and an editorial backoffice.
- Bun-powered CLI & tooling – automates deployments, domain assignment, renewals, and indexing.
The following requirements capture the initial hackathon scope and should remain synchronized with active development.
Core Requirements
Content & Access
- Support public or private visibility modes. Consider sponsored transactions so editors can zkLogin without paying gas.
- Payments: define who funds new content, renewals, and edits. Enable contract-sponsored transactions.
- Editing workflow: editors propose changes into a queue; authorized users approve and publish.
- Storage strategy: allow Walrus quilts (multi-file blobs). Consider grouping related files to share permissions. Small artefacts (comments) may go on-chain.
- Indexing: determine whether to maintain an off-chain indexer for discoverability and search metadata.
- Editing history: track version diffs so previous states remain accessible.
Product Modes
- Wikipedia/Wordpress/Blog: public content, hierarchical editors, deployer funds operations.
- Company Website: structured layout, public, deployer-funded edits.
- Crowd-sourced Wikipedia: each page maintains its own balance (crowd-funding); tombstone when unfunded.
- Dark Wikipedia / Directory / Reddit: pay-to-list directory stored on-chain; contract escrows listing funds and can finance its Walrus frontend.
- Forum / Discussion: threads with comments, author edits, moderator removals, hierarchical ownership.

Implementation Details
Current Architecture
- Pages: Stored as
PageRecordstructs in a vector within Press3 shared object - Access Control: Admins (global) and Editors (per-page)
- Content Storage: Walrus blob IDs referenced from contract
- Frontend: React SPA with public renderer and admin panel
- CLI: Bun-based tooling for deployment and management
Data Flow
- Page Creation: Admin creates page → Upload to Walrus → Register in contract
- Page Update: Admin/Editor edits → Upload new version to Walrus → Update contract reference
- Public View: User requests page → Fetch from contract → Retrieve from Walrus → Render
- Editor Management: Admin promotes/demotes editors → Contract updates editors list
Key Design Decisions
- Pages stored in vector (not as separate objects) for simpler querying
- Editors list per page (not group-based yet)
- Multi-step Walrus upload (register + certify) with progress tracking
- Layout configuration via special pages (e.g.,
/_layout.json) - Content type detection by file extension and MIME type
